When You Were Me  (Robert Rodi Essentials) by Robert Rodi
At 53, Jack Ackerly is sitting on top of the world. Thanks to a lifetime of hard work and strategic business deals, he's rich, retired, and set for life. Only trouble is... he can't help regretting the wild oats he never sowed. At 26, Corey Szaslow has been living the life of Jack Ackerly's fantasies: a never-ending round of bars, parties, and one-night-stands. Only trouble is.. he can't help regretting the dead-end future that's ahead of him. If only Jack and Corey could trade places! Enter a brilliant (if rather dithering) witch named Francesca, who helpfully places Jack's mind in Corey's body, and Corey's in Jacks—and each considers his problems solved. But they soon discover that inhabiting each other's bodies is a hell of a lot easier than living each other's lives. Uproariously funny, unexpectedly moving, and uncannily insightful about the arc of a gay man's life, When You Were Me was the culmination of Robert Rodi's exploration of gay archetypes when it was first published in 2007. It's finally back in print... and like Jack and Corey, enjoying a whole new life of its own.
